How to connect Google slides and Github

Create a New Scenario to Connect Google slides and Github

In the workspace, click the “Create New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a Google slides, triggered by another scenario, or executed manually (for testing purposes). In most cases, Google slides or Github will be your first step. To do this, click "Choose an app," find Google slides or Github, and select the appropriate trigger to start the scenario.

Add the Google slides Node

Select the Google slides node from the app selection panel on the right.

Save and Activate the Scenario

After configuring Google slides, Github,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king “Run once” and triggering an event to check if the Google slides and Github integration works as expected. Depending on your setup, data should flow between Google slides and Github (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Most powerful ways to connect Google slides and Github

Github + Google Slides + Slack: When a new push is made to a Github repository, find a specified Google Slides presentation, and then send a Slack message to notify a channel about the updated presentation related to the project proposal.

Github + Google Slides + Google Drive: When new code is pushed to a Github repository, create a new presentation based on a template in Google Slides, and then save that presentation to a designated folder in Google Drive.

Are there any limitations to the Google slides and Github integ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• Rate limits imposed by the Google slides and Github APIs apply.
  • Complex slide formatting may require custom JavaScript coding.
  • Large slide decks might experience longer processing times.
